         <title>directed drawings</title>
         <author></author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/april_vazquez/j7mzbxy65kwzszt5/wish/1065509296</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>Directed drawings  are verbalized steps to complete a picture, but not shown.  The group shares their final drawings at the same time as the teacher at the end.</div>]]></description>
